The cache saves sections of websites, such as photos, to make them open faster on your next visit. They improve your internet experience by preserving browsing data. These cached data and cookies are used by your web browser to help improve the loading speeds of previously visited sites.Ĭookies are little files that are produced by the web page you visit.
